The S&W 6904 is a DA/SA semiautomatic pistol with an aluminum alloy frame and a carbon steel slide chambered in 9mm with a magazine capacity of 12 rounds. Smith & Wesson offered this pistol from 1990 to about 1998. Based on the serial number on this pistol, its manufacture date is 1991.
